How to Pronounce "keep your eye on the ball"
expression
KEEP yor EYE on thuh BAWL
KEEP yaw EYE on thuh BAWL
Definition
This expression means to stay focused on what is important or to pay close attention to a task. It often comes from sports but is used for any situation that needs concentration.
